Tech Stock Surges Over 6% in Morning Trade; Brokerage Reaffirms Top Pick Status

Shares of TIME INTERCON (01729) climbed more than 8% during intraday trading before settling 6.34% higher at HK$17.78, with turnover reaching HK$292 million by the time of writing.

The company posted its interim results for fiscal 2026, reporting revenue of approximately HK$10.066 billion, a year-on-year increase of 107.4%. Net profit attributable to shareholders rose roughly 1.64 times to about HK$828 million, with basic earnings per share of HK$0.3949 and an interim dividend of HK$0.06 per share.

The substantial revenue growth was driven by three key factors: the consolidation of the Dejinchang acquisition contributed HK$2.89 billion in revenue from the copper wire business; server segment revenue expanded 68% year-on-year; and data center-related revenue within the wire and cable components division, led by MPO products, grew 23%.

According to CMSC, the company's first-half net profit attributable to parent reached HK$830 million, up 164% year-on-year, landing near the upper end of the previously guided range. The brokerage noted solid contributions across MPO, servers, Leoni, and the copper wire segment.

The firm maintains its earlier view that the market significantly underestimates the value of TIME INTERCON's computing power business. While the MPO core business continues to grow rapidly, new products such as optical communication CPO and 800V power cables are poised for imminent volume ramp-up.

At the current share price level, the company's undervaluation is evident, leaving substantial upside potential. Given the likelihood of results exceeding expectations, CMSC reiterates its "strong buy" rating on the stock.
